Frequently Asked Questions About Insurance in Bonner

What are the minimum auto insurance requirements in Bonner, Montana?

Montana state law requires all drivers in Bonner to carry liability insurance with minimum limits of 25/50/20: $25,000 for bodily injury per person, $50,000 for bodily injury per accident, and $20,000 for property damage. Given Bonner's rural location and potential for wildlife collisions, many residents opt for higher limits and comprehensive coverage.

How does living near the Blackfoot River affect my homeowners insurance in Bonner?

Properties near the Blackfoot River may face increased flood risk, which is not covered by standard homeowners policies. Bonner residents should consider purchasing separate flood insurance through the NFIP, especially given Montana's spring snowmelt and occasional heavy rainfall that can cause river levels to rise significantly.

What special considerations should Bonner residents have for wildfire insurance coverage?

Given Bonner's location in wildfire-prone western Montana, homeowners should ensure their policy adequately covers wildfire damage and includes additional living expenses if evacuation is necessary. Many insurers now require defensible space around properties, so maintaining cleared vegetation can help maintain coverage and potentially lower premiums.

Are there unique health insurance considerations for Bonner's rural community?

Bonner residents should prioritize health plans with strong networks including providers in nearby Missoula, as local healthcare options are limited. Many residents also consider supplemental coverage for emergency medical transport, which can be crucial in this rural area where specialized care may require transportation to larger medical facilities.

What insurance should Bonner business owners consider for seasonal weather risks?

Bonner businesses should ensure their commercial property insurance covers damage from heavy snowfall, ice dams, and freezing temperatures common in western Montana winters. Additionally, business interruption coverage is important for weather-related closures, while liability insurance should address slip-and-fall risks during icy conditions on business premises.

Finding Cheap Car Insurance Companies in Bonner, Montana: A Local's Guide

Living in Bonner, Montana, offers a unique blend of scenic beauty and practical challenges, especially when it comes to car insurance. Nestled near the Clark Fork River and surrounded by rugged terrain, Bonner residents need coverage that fits both their budgets and their lifestyles. Finding cheap car insurance companies here isn't just about the lowest price—it's about securing reliable protection that accounts for local factors like harsh winters, wildlife crossings, and the mix of highway and rural driving. Many Bonner drivers commute to Missoula for work or venture into the backcountry for recreation, making tailored coverage essential. Start by understanding Montana's minimum liability requirements, which include $25,000 for bodily injury per person, $50,000 per accident, and $20,000 for property damage. However, given Montana's high rate of rural accidents, consider increasing these limits for better financial safety. To identify cheap car insurance companies in Bonner, leverage your local connections. Smaller regional insurers or agencies based in Montana often offer competitive rates because they understand the state's specific risks, such as deer collisions on Highway 200 or icy roads in winter. These providers might not advertise nationally, but they can deliver personalized service and discounts for factors like low mileage if you're mainly driving around Bonner or nearby Milltown. Another tip is to bundle your auto policy with other insurance, like homeowners or renters coverage, which many insurers in the area promote. Bonner's demographics, including a mix of families, outdoor enthusiasts, and retirees, mean that insurance needs vary widely. If you're a safe driver with a clean record, ask about usage-based programs that track your driving habits—these can lead to significant savings, especially if you avoid peak traffic times on routes to Missoula. Additionally, maintaining a good credit score can help lower premiums, as Montana allows insurers to use credit-based pricing. Don't overlook discounts for safety features like anti-lock brakes or for completing defensive driving courses, which are valuable on Montana's winding roads. When comparing cheap car insurance companies, read reviews from fellow Montanans to gauge customer service and claims handling. Local agents in Bonner or Missoula can provide insights into which companies respond quickly after incidents, such as hailstorms or winter crashes. Remember, the cheapest policy might not cover everything you need, so balance cost with comprehensive protection that includes uninsured motorist coverage, given Montana's higher-than-average rate of uninsured drivers.
